On Tue, Mar 11, 2003 at 02:00:30PM +1100, Lisman, Jarrad FLGOFF wrote:
> Hi, I am just experimenting with task and autopsy and am having some
> troubles. Every time (I have done it on two different systems now) that I
> try to create the data and timeline files in autopsy, the data creation
> seems to go fine but when doing the timeline I get a Malformed UTF-8
> Character error.
This message is a known 'bug', but I'm not sure if it has an effect on
the output. It is from a Perl module that mactime uses (DateManip)
and the new Perl that comes with RH 8.0 does not like some of the
international encodings. If I knew Portuguese, I would fix it. I
emailed the author a while back, but did not hear back. If you are
using "american"-style dates though, then I think it is ok.
> This then brings up garbage in the timeline file. On
> further inspection I find that there is spurious characters indicitive of
> binary in the body file (These are causing the Malformed UTF Character error
> I would say) So that implies to me that fls and ils seem to be outputting
> some binary stuff where they are not meant to be.
What version of TASK do you have? Version 1.60 fixed a bug that
existed in timelines where the destination of symbolic links was
not null terminated.
If you are using 1.60, can you send me a copy of the body file or
at least the offending lines (off list).
